Job Title: Quality Control (QC) Inspector – Above Ground Tank ConstructionJob Type: Full-TimePosition Overview:The company is seeking a detail-oriented and experienced Quality Control (QC) Inspector with a strong background in above ground storage tank (AST) construction. The QC Inspector will be responsible for ensuring that all phases of tank fabrication, welding, assembly, and testing comply with applicable codes, client specifications, project drawings, and internal quality standards.This role requires field-based inspection on active construction sites and may involve travel to various project locations across the [Region, e.g., Rocky Mountain region or Western U.S.].Key Responsibilities:Perform inspections of above ground tank fabrication and erection to ensure compliance with:API 650, API 653, AWWA, ASME, AWS D1.1, and other applicable codesReview and verify welding procedures (WPS), welder qualifications (WPQ), and ensure compliance during field welding activitiesMonitor fit-up, alignment, and dimensional tolerances during tank assemblyConduct visual weld inspections and coordinate non-destructive examination (NDE) activities such as:Magnetic particle testing (MT)Ultrasonic testing (UT)Radiographic testing (RT)Document all inspections and generate detailed reports and NCRs (non-conformance reports) as neededReview mill test reports (MTRs), material certifications, and ensure traceability of materials usedWitness hydrostatic testing and perform final punch list inspections prior to tank commissioningCoordinate with Project Managers, Engineers, and subcontractors to resolve quality-related issuesSupport QA/QC audits and ensure adherence to the project’s Quality Control Plan
